It's all about the change in the front suspension, people have been looking for at least ten years for some that work good. Sure I've got some more but my mornig coffee is getting cold! Ought to give you an idea at least.
Here is how someone got a nice set of Mustang headers to work on his coil spring front end. He had to raise the motor 1 1/2-2" to clear the motor mount and then the tubes got in the way of the steering shaft. Said it took $350 worth of joints, support bearing and new shaft to clear.

The original poster is talking about a 1998 or newer vehicle, that is the difference. Tri-Ys and the swap headers being discussed fit an Ibeam truck, but the newer rack and pinion trucks are problematic. I'd still love to see how close a tri-y is on those, however!
 
I am not a spring front end, I have torsion bars. Would that make a difference?
 
I think you only choices are the same as if you had a coil front end, Think the coil frames have even more room around the suspension. It's not really the problem of fitting between the frame rails but getting around the steering and suspension. (?)
